Transaction 95e56cb78b6d8281895e8742dee62d9448b89552f6f7756887654912777400e0
1 Input
1 Output
-
95e56cb78b6d8281895e8742dee62d9448b89552f6f7756887654912777400e0:0
- value
- 3792810
- script pubkey
- OP_0 OP_PUSHBYTES_20 6120e8160219eaa4f9457e2ec339cdeb00b6ee88
- address
- bc1qvysws9szr842f7290chvxwwdavqtdm5g68w0cu